Komal Bajaj, M.D.

Komal Bajaj

Professor, Department of Obstetrics & Gynecology and Women's Health

Area of Research: healthcare quality, medical simulation, healthcare equity & reproductive genetics.

Professional Interests

Dr. Komal Bajaj is an innovator, catalyst, and advocate in the Bronx.  She is Chief Quality Officer at NYC Health + Hospitals/Jacobi and Clinical Director for NYC Health + Hospital's Simulation Center
